6 Plumbing Mistakes That Turn Small Drips Into Big Repairs

a man working on a pipe in a wall

We’ve all been there – you hear that annoying drip-drip-drip sound and think, “It’s just a little leak; I’ll get to it later.” But let’s be real: that small drip can quickly turn into a waterfall if you’re not careful. Plumbing mishaps can sneak up on you, becoming bigger headaches than you ever imagined. So, let’s chat about some common plumbing mistakes that can escalate your woes from minor annoyances to major repairs.

1. Ignoring the Drip

It starts innocently enough. You notice a tiny drip under the sink, and your brain says, “It’s just a little water. What’s the worst that could happen?” Well, my friend, that little drip is like the tip of an iceberg. If you don’t address it, you could end up with mold, water damage, or worse—a broken pipe. So, next time you hear that pesky sound, don’t brush it off. Grab your toolbox or call a professional before it’s too late!

2. DIY Plumbing Gone Wrong

There’s something satisfying about fixing things yourself, right? But plumbing can be a slippery slope—literally. One wrong turn with a wrench and you could find yourself knee-deep in water, not to mention a hefty repair bill. If you’re not sure what you’re doing, it might be best to leave it to the pros. And let’s face it, nobody wants to be the person who turned a simple faucet replacement into a full-on plumbing crisis.

3. Skipping Regular Maintenance

We schedule oil changes for our cars and dentist appointments for our teeth, but when it comes to plumbing, we often forget about regular check-ups. Just like your car, your plumbing system needs a little TLC too! A yearly inspection can catch small issues before they turn into catastrophic failures. It’s like preventative medicine for your pipes—except there’s no waiting room involved!

4. Overlooking the Importance of Proper Tools

Ever tried to fix a leaky faucet with a pair of kitchen scissors? Yeah, not the best idea. Using the right tools can make or break your plumbing project. Investing in a good-quality wrench, plumber’s tape, or even a simple bucket can save you from a world of trouble. It’s like trying to bake a soufflé with a spatula—possible, but you’ll probably end up with a flat mess!

5. Not Knowing When to Call a Professional

This one’s a biggie. Sometimes, we think we can handle it all, but there’s a fine line between DIY and “Oh no, what did I do?” If a project feels overwhelming or if you’re dealing with something more serious like a sewage backup or a burst pipe, don’t hesitate to call in the experts. They have the experience and tools needed to tackle the problem efficiently. Plus, you’ll save yourself the stress of a potential plumbing disaster.

6. Neglecting Your Pipes in Extreme Weather

Winter is beautiful, but let’s be honest: it can wreak havoc on your plumbing. Many folks forget that their pipes need protection from freezing temperatures. If you live in a colder climate, insulating your pipes can prevent them from bursting when the mercury drops. And trust me, a burst pipe is not the kind of surprise you want when you’re cozying up with hot cocoa!

Conclusion

So, there you have it! A little awareness can go a long way in preventing those small drips from evolving into major repairs. By addressing leaks promptly, using the right tools, and knowing when to call in a professional, you can save yourself time, money, and a whole lot of frustration. Remember, your plumbing system is like a friendship—it needs care and attention to thrive. So, give it the love it deserves, and you’ll be rewarded with a happy, leak-free home!
